Transaction 0e0581f5d046b94f0cdc4c4ea47730333581309cb043dfd0774e092616015f7d

144 Input
2 Outputs
  • 0e0581f5d046b94f0cdc4c4ea47730333581309cb043dfd0774e092616015f7d:0
  • value  410569224
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 0e0581f5d046b94f0cdc4c4ea47730333581309cb043dfd0774e092616015f7d:1
  • value  5476627
    address  36bVarWLvqcDZ4QAXe7xGtFE59v7f7obRX